Understanding Tempo in Resistance Training

Tempo refers to the speed at which you perform each phase of a repetition. For a pushup, this typically breaks down into three main phases, often represented by a four-digit code (e.g., 2-0-1-0):

  • Eccentric Phase (Lowering): The controlled descent as you lower your chest towards the ground. This is often the first number in a tempo code (e.g., '2' seconds).
  • Isometric Hold (Bottom/Transition): The pause at the bottom of the movement, or the brief transition between eccentric and concentric. This is the second number (e.g., '0' seconds).
  • Concentric Phase (Pushing): The upward movement as you push your body back to the starting position. This is the third number (e.g., '1' second).
  • Isometric Hold (Top/Transition): The pause at the top, or the brief transition before the next repetition. This is the fourth number (e.g., '0' seconds).

Understanding these phases is crucial for manipulating tempo effectively.

The Case for Slower Pushups (Controlled Tempo)

Performing pushups with a slower, more controlled tempo (e.g., 2-1-2-1 or 3-0-2-0) offers several advantages:

  • Increased Time Under Tension (TUT): By extending the duration of each rep, more stress is placed on the muscle fibers. This prolonged tension is a key stimulus for muscle hypertrophy (growth) and muscular endurance.
  • Enhanced Muscle Activation and Mind-Muscle Connection: Slower movements force you to actively engage the target muscles (pectorals, deltoids, triceps) throughout the entire range of motion. This improves proprioception and allows for better recruitment of motor units.
  • Improved Form and Injury Prevention: A deliberate pace allows you to focus meticulously on maintaining proper technique, ensuring joint alignment, and preventing compensatory movements. This significantly reduces the risk of injury, especially for beginners or those working on form correction.
  • Greater Strength Development: While power is about speed, raw strength often benefits from controlled, maximal force application over a longer period, particularly in the eccentric phase where muscles can handle greater loads.
  • Increased Metabolic Stress: Prolonged muscle contraction can lead to a buildup of metabolic byproducts (like lactate), which are also thought to contribute to muscle growth.

The Case for Faster Pushups (Explosive Tempo)

Incorporating faster, more explosive pushups (e.g., 1-0-X-0, where 'X' denotes maximal speed) targets different physiological adaptations:

  • Power Development: Explosive movements are crucial for developing power, which is the ability to generate maximal force in the shortest amount of time (Force x Velocity). This is vital for athletic performance in sports requiring rapid movements like jumping, throwing, or sprinting.
  • Rate of Force Development (RFD): Faster tempos train your nervous system to activate muscle fibers more rapidly and synchronously, improving your RFD. This translates to quicker, more powerful actions.
  • Recruitment of Fast-Twitch Muscle Fibers: Explosive movements preferentially engage fast-twitch muscle fibers (Type IIx), which have the greatest potential for strength and power output.
  • Increased Metabolic Demand and Calorie Burn: Performing exercises at a higher intensity and speed generally elevates your heart rate and metabolic demand, contributing to greater energy expenditure during the workout.
  • Functional Strength: Many real-world activities and sports require rapid, forceful movements. Training with explosive tempos helps bridge the gap between gym strength and functional movement.

The Role of Isometric Holds

While not strictly "fast" or "slow," incorporating isometric holds (e.g., pausing for 1-3 seconds at the bottom or top of the pushup) can further enhance benefits:

  • Increased Time Under Tension: Directly increases TUT.
  • Strength at Specific Joint Angles: Builds strength precisely where the hold occurs, often targeting sticking points.
  • Enhanced Stability: Improves control and stability, especially at challenging positions.

How to Choose Your Pushup Tempo (Goal-Oriented Approach)

Your fitness goals should dictate your tempo choice:

  • For Muscle Hypertrophy (Growth) and Endurance: Focus on slower, controlled tempos (e.g., 2-1-2-1 or 3-0-2-0). Emphasize the eccentric phase (lowering) for 2-3 seconds.
  • For Raw Strength and Stability: Utilize moderate to slow tempos (e.g., 2-0-1-0 or 3-0-1-0). Ensure full control throughout the movement.
  • For Power and Athleticism: Prioritize an explosive concentric phase (pushing up as fast as possible, 'X') while maintaining a controlled eccentric (e.g., 2-0-X-0).
  • For Beginners and Form Mastery: Start with very slow and deliberate tempos (e.g., 3-1-3-1 or even slower) to engrain proper movement patterns and build foundational strength and stability before attempting speed.

Combining Tempos for Comprehensive Development

The most effective training programs often incorporate a variety of tempos over time. This concept, known as periodization, allows you to target different physiological adaptations without overtraining or plateauing.

  • You might dedicate specific training blocks or days to hypertrophy-focused slow tempos.
  • Another block could focus on power development with explosive reps.
  • Even within a single workout, you could vary tempo – perhaps starting with a few sets of slow, controlled reps for muscle activation, then moving to faster reps for power.

Key Considerations for All Tempos

Regardless of the tempo you choose, these principles remain paramount:

  • Proper Form is Non-Negotiable: Never sacrifice form for speed or perceived difficulty. Incorrect form increases injury risk and reduces effectiveness.
  • Progressive Overload: To continue making progress, you must continually challenge your muscles. This can be done by increasing repetitions, sets, reducing rest, increasing resistance (e.g., weighted pushups), or manipulating tempo.
  • Listen to Your Body: Pay attention to how your body responds. If a certain tempo causes pain, adjust it or consult a professional.
